Heading to Exmouth in a few weeks and trying to find out how many drooper lines i can have on a patanosta rig in that region . I know you can only have one in the metro area but is it different for Exmouth . Cant find any info on fisheries website and i did ring a tackle store in Exmouth and they think you can have 2 up there , bit strange that they didnt know for sure . Thanks for any info

Straight outta fisheries
Straight outta fisheries guidlines:
Fishing rigs – you can only use a maximum of 1 bait or lure on each line in the West Coast bioregion when fishing for demersal scalefish, 3 baits or lures on each line in all other areas and for other categories of fish
